Transaction e588476f148df3837a3796db9a005c0f04c31be959e0b5931377eb39369e0804
1 Input
1 Output
-
e588476f148df3837a3796db9a005c0f04c31be959e0b5931377eb39369e0804:0
- value
- 405586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ffa9bfbfa031f303612b7f5eea7a774099a88ab OP_EQUAL
- address
- 3DMhxYez4Gw2dhchZn9GUKWAo2UL285c3X